Facebook Inc (NASDAQ:FB)’s monster IPO fed investor frenzy in May by increasing the size of its offering by almost 25 percent, adding about 84 million shares to the issue. The issue has been an unmitigated disaster for investors, currently trading at $20.87 against the issue price of $38. Worse has been the impact on subsequent IPOs of other companies as they meet with investor indifference to their offerings.
